Transaction 2a65e21729acfc26a3c70cc106fd6f2f6fe1c7e4686da2968ce6f05f0e616ed3

block
2fbf2859bb94bac1358f47bf16750bda06b16e00793a367f4d5ca8c608b27934

1 Input

24 Outputs